What Is the Median Home Value in Colfax County, Nebraska?

$144,700/home 12.3%vs 2023 ($128,800)

County · Census ACS 5-Year estimates

The median home value in Colfax County, Nebraska is $144,700 (±$28,249), based on Census ACS 5-Year estimates (2024). The median gross rent is $980/month, and the median household income is $82,530/year. Source: U.S. Census Bureau, American Community Survey, 2024 5-Year Estimates.

How reliable is Census ACS data for small areas?

The ACS 5-Year estimates combine 60 months of data for more reliable figures in smaller geographies. Each estimate has a margin of error (MOE). For example, the median home value of $144,700 has a margin of error of ±$28,249. In very small areas, MOEs can be large relative to the estimate.
